Abstract
The invention is a display device comprising a solid top transparent, charge conducting material, positioned below the transparent solid material is an active layer comprising an electrochromic material and an electrolyte, and positioned below the active layer is a working electrode and a counter-electrode arranged to be isolated from one another, wherein the distance between the working and the counter electrode is greater than two times the thickness of the active layer between the electrode and the conductive material.

14. A display device comprising a top transparent layer charge conducting material, positioned below the top transparent material an active layer comprising
(a) a compound that undergoes an electron transfer reaction with subsequent change in its protic state (b) at least one indicator dye which changes color when a change in pH occurs, and (c) an ionically conductive material and optionally component (d), a matrix material, wherein components (a), (b), (c), and (d) are different from one another and component (a) preferentially undergoes the electron transfer reaction when a charge is applied to the composition and positioned below the active layer a working electrode and a counter-electrode arranged to be isolated from one another wherein the distance between the working electrode and the counter electrode is greater than two times the thickness of the active layer between the electrode and the transparent conductive material.
